Darrion Trammell
Updated on 4/4/23. Written by Alan Lu.
Height: 5-10
Weight: 175
College: San Diego State
Classification: Senior
Birthdate: 10/20/2000
Projected Draft Range: Likely Undrafted
Pros:
Decent scorer off the dribble
Adequate shooter
Decent playmaker
Decent defender that can get steals
Above average athlete
Cons:
Inconsistent shooter
Can struggle to score in traffic
Needs to improve his rebounding
May struggle to defend taller players
Undersized for his position
Summary:
Darrion Trammell is an agile, skilled playmaker that is on a very good San Diego State team this year. After starring at Seattle University, he transferred to play for the Aztecs this season. He scored 21 points to help lead his team to a surprising upset win over 1st seeded Alabama in the Sweet 16 of the 2023 NCAA Tournament. He has struggled to be consistent with his jump shot this year, but he’s shown that he can shoot and pass the basketball when counted upon, and he could project into a backup point guard role in the NBA.
